Forum holds a 100% interest in 95,500 hectares of ground adjacent to Orano's 133 million pound Kiggavik uranium project. Interpretation of historic uranium assay results from drilling in 2010 and 2011 on trend from Forum's drilling on the Tatiggaq deposit this summer confirms the potential to extend mineralization for up to 1.25 kilometres. Intersection of uranium mineralization shows continuity and consistency of high-grade mineralization 25 m east-northeast of TAT23-002 drilled this summer. The historical intercepts are as follows:
TUR-021 intersected 3.51% U3O8 over 7.6 m (from 148.1 - 155.7 m) including: 13.8% U3O8 over 1.2 m (153.3 - 154.5 m)
TUR-026 intersected 1.0% U3O8 over 14.9 m (from 177.6 - 192.5 m) including: 2.21% U3O8 over 4.6 m (184.0 - 188.6 m)
TUR-040 intersected 1.14% U3O8 over 9.0 m (from 159.1 - 168.1 m) including: 4.09% U3O8 over 0.5 m (159.6 - 160.1 m)
2.81% U3O8 over 2.5 m (162.5 - 165.0 m)

The historic uranium intersections provide further evidence of the high-grade uranium mineralization potential of the Tatiggaq deposit. These holes show that the Tatiggaq fault is fertile for additional mineralization along this favourable trend. The 2023 drill program and re-evaluation of the historical holes confirms steep-dipping, high-grade sub-parallel uranium lenses present over 250 m along trend.
Tatiggaq Interpretation
Mineralization within the Tatiggaq deposit consists of two zones - the Main and West Zones and is located at depths between 80 and 180 m. The mineralization is hosted in a series of high-grade subparallel, steep, south-dipping fault zones that sit within a 50 m wide area. Individual high-grade mineralized structures are up to 10 m in width. The entire 0.7 km wide by 1.5 km long Tatiggaq gravity anomaly remains open for additional uranium mineralization both along strike of the known zones but also along numerous sub-parallel fault zones to the north and south.
